//! This library can be used to acquire oauth2.0 authentication for services. //! At the time of writing, only one way of doing so is implemented, the //! [device flow](https://developers.google.com/youtube/v3/guides/authentication#devices), along //! with a flow //! for [refreshing tokens](https://developers.google.com/youtube/v3/guides/authentication#devices) //! //! For your application to use this library, you will have to obtain an application //! id and secret by //! [following this guide](https://developers.google.com/youtube/registering_an_application). //! //! # Device Flow Usage //! As the `DeviceFlow` involves polling, the `DeviceFlowHelper` should be used //! as means to adhere to the protocol, and remain resilient to all kinds of errors //! that can occour on the way. //! //! # Installed Flow Usage //! The `InstalledFlow` involves showing a URL to the user (or opening it in a browser) //! and then either prompting the user to enter a displayed code, or make the authorizing //! website redirect to a web server spun up by this library. //! In order to use the interactive method, use the `InstalledInteractive` `FlowType`; //! for the redirect method, use `InstalledRedirect`, with the port number to let the //! server listen on. //! You can implement your own `AuthenticatorDelegate` in order to customize the flow; //! the `InstalledFlow` uses the `present_user_url` method. //! //!
